## Changelog — PurgeWarden 1.9.3

Rotated the artifact signing key for the data-retention sweeper following the scheduled quarterly rotation. All sweeper bundles from 1.9.3 onward are signed with the new key; older releases remain verifiable against the archived key in the vault. No behavioral changes to retention windows or purge schedules. Release manager action: update the promotion pipeline's trust store before the next deploy, or verification will fail. The new signing key for all subsequent releases is as follows.

rollout seal: bky4_x7Gc

**Mgmt Meeting Minutes — Retiring the Brightline Range**

Quick recap for sales leads at Fenholt Supplies: we agreed to retire the Brightline fixture range by year-end. Remaining stock moves to clearance pricing next month, and accounts on standing orders get migrated to the Lumetta range. Trade-in incentives were approved in principle. The confidential note on next steps sits just below.

board note of bajof-bajeg: The pricing group signed off on a budget of $13.4 million for Project Sildor. The renewal with Lamixek Holdings closes at $48.9 million a year, 49 percent above the last contract.

Subject: Log sampling on Chirpline now live

Team — Chirpline was emitting ~40k lines/min, mostly duplicate heartbeat noise. We enabled 1:50 sampling on INFO and below as of this release. ERROR and WARN are untouched. If you're new: don't expect full INFO coverage in Lograft anymore; use the sampled view. Rollback flag is chirpline.sampling.enabled. The deployed build is tagged below.

session token of kahif-kageg = htk14_01cd78718aea51

Incremental rebuilds are now enabled by default for all Stonemill sites. Previously, any content change triggered a full rebuild; as of 4.2.0, only pages affected by changed content and their dependents are regenerated. Full rebuilds still occur on template or config changes. Cache invalidation granularity moved from section-level to page-level, and the dependency graph persists between builds. Sites pinned to the old behavior must opt out explicitly. The new default configuration values are listed below.

service settings:
PRAIX_LOG_LEVEL=error
PRAIX_METRICS_HOST=metrics.praix.qorvelcorp.corp
PRAIX_POOL_SIZE=16